Where is 5 Sassafras Place located within Isabella Plains?

The house is situated in the suburb of Isabella Plains, which is bordered by Isabella Drive, Drakeford Drive, Johnson Drive and Ashley Drive. It neighbours the suburbs of Monash, Bonython, Richardson and Calwell

What shopping and medical amenities are nearby?

A small shopping centre on the corner of Ellerston Avenue and Galloway Street offers a supermarket, hairdresser, chemist, pathology clinic and a takeaway shop. A doctors' surgery is located opposite the shops, providing convenient health services

How far is Tuggeranong Creek from the property?

Tuggeranong Creek is roughly 0.7 km away, making it a short walk or easy bike ride from the house

What community facilities are close to 5 Sassafras Place?

The Isabella Plains Neighbourhood Centre shares a car park with the local shops and can be hired for community events. It also hosts daytime playgroups for parents and young children

What underlying geology characterises the area around the property?

The suburb rests on Deakin Volcanics comprising green‑grey and purple rhyodacite from the Silurian period. In the lower‑lying parts this volcanic rock is overlain by alluvial deposits
